IWhat to watch for

In the preterite, poner swaps its stem for pus- and takes the special strong endings with no accent marks: puse, pusiste, puso, pusimos, pusieron. If you write 'ponié' or put an accent on puse, the irregular stem has slipped away from you.

The other classic trap is choosing puse when the sentence describes a past habit — that job belongs to the imperfect ponía. Watch for completed-event markers like ayer, anoche and de repente: they are your green light for the pus- forms.

IIConjugation
ponerPreterite
yo
puse
pusiste
él / ella / usted
puso
nosotros
pusimos
vosotros
pusisteis
ellos / ustedes
pusieron
Irregular yo (pongo), strong preterite stem pus-, future stem pondr-.
